What's Mastodon & Should Social Media Marketers Keep it on Their Radar?

A new social network has taken the internet by storm, and it goes by the name of Mastodon.Having amassed a following of almost two million active users by this January, the platform is described as an alternative to Twitter.So what does this new name have to offer marketers?And can your brand benefit from having a presence on it?
Read at Hubspot